**Ticket #4471 — Expired creds: Pondwright pooler**

Heads up, new folks: the Pondwright connection pooler stopped handing out database connections this morning because its service credential expired. Classic. Apps will show "pool exhausted" errors until it's fixed. We've minted a fresh credential and the pooler config just needs updating. For reference, the replacement key is:

app token of bahaf-tajeg = zpat23_SjjsllwiLmXbtS65veZaV47

**Release checklist — Parcelwing 2.9**

- [ ] Confirm the carrier-status webhook retries with backoff and doesn't double-fire the "delivered" event. Dorsey saw duplicates in the Hatley sandbox last cycle, so smoke-test against a slow consumer before sign-off. Once the replay test passes cleanly, note the verified build here:

session token of tajef-bageg = htk21_5d90d574934f3ccae6437

Oldport delivery used fixed-interval retries. The new Quillgate dispatcher uses exponential backoff with jitter. Key differences: retries stop after the max attempt count instead of looping forever; failed deliveries land in a dead-letter table; 410 responses disable the endpoint immediately. Do not re-enable endpoints without checking the dead-letter backlog first. Migrate consumers before enabling the new dispatcher, not after. Apply the following configuration to the dispatcher before cut-over; current production values are listed here:

settings of tagef-bawif:
DRUIX_HOST=druix.zemvarlabs.internal
DRUIX_PORT=8000